Security Apache忽略SSLRequire指令
我已经设置了Apache来提供Subversion数据。配置如下所示Security Apache忽略SSLRequire指令,security,apache,ssl,apache2,Security,Apache,Ssl,Apache2,我已经设置了Apache来提供Subversion数据。配置如下所示 <Location /svn> DAV svn SVNPath /path/to/svn AuthType Basic AuthName "My Project" AuthUserFile /etc/httpd/dav_svn.passwd Require valid-user SSLRequireSSL <LimitExcept GET PROPFIND OPTIONS REPORT>
<Location /svn>
DAV svn
SVNPath /path/to/svn
AuthType Basic
AuthName "My Project"
AuthUserFile /etc/httpd/dav_svn.passwd
Require valid-user
SSLRequireSSL
<LimitExcept GET PROPFIND OPTIONS REPORT>
Require valid-user
</LimitExcept>
</Location>
及
导致同样的行为!它们都允许非SSL连接
我错过了什么
(Apache版本:2.2.11)我认为您需要:
SSLOptions+StrictRequire
谢谢,但它仍然不起作用!向上投票,因为它显然走在正确的轨道上。
SSLRequire true
SSLRequire false